首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

WSO2:同用户的API的接入token是否可以使用?

WSO2是一个开源的企业级集成平台,提供了一套完整的API管理解决方案。在WSO2中,用户的API接入token可以使用,这是通过OAuth 2.0协议来实现的。

OAuth 2.0是一种授权框架,用于授权第三方应用访问用户资源。在WSO2中,用户可以通过OAuth 2.0协议生成访问令牌(Access Token),并将其用于API的访问控制。Access Token是一种临时凭证,用于验证API请求的合法性和权限。

使用Access Token可以实现以下优势:

  1. 安全性:Access Token可以有效保护用户的敏感数据,只有持有有效的Token才能访问API。
  2. 灵活性:通过Access Token,用户可以控制第三方应用对其资源的访问权限,可以随时撤销或更新Token。
  3. 用户体验:Access Token可以减少用户在每次API请求时的身份验证步骤,提高用户体验。

WSO2的API管理解决方案可以广泛应用于各个行业和场景,例如:

  1. 电子商务:通过API管理,实现商品信息、订单管理、支付接口等的统一管理和控制。
  2. 金融服务:提供安全的API接口,用于用户身份验证、支付授权、账户信息查询等。
  3. 物联网:通过API管理,实现设备数据的采集、存储和分析,支持物联网应用的开发和管理。

在腾讯云中,可以使用腾讯云API网关(API Gateway)来实现类似的功能。腾讯云API网关是一种高性能、高可用的API管理服务,提供了丰富的功能和工具,用于API的发布、访问控制、流量管理等。您可以通过腾讯云API网关来管理和保护您的API,并实现用户的API接入token的使用。

更多关于腾讯云API网关的信息,请参考:腾讯云API网关产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

api接口安全设计:使用token+sign+时间戳

服务端以api方式将数据响应给客户端是目前趋势,可以用在前后端分离架构中,前后端分离之后,前后端人员能够更加专注于自己板块东西,也可以用在服务端与服务端相互调用中。...api接口就要使用安全验证。...一、使用token进行用户身份认证用户身份认证流程图如下:图片具体说明如下:①、用户登录时,客户端请求接口,传入用户名和密码②、服务端对用户身份进行验证。...其中,rediskey为token,value为验证通过后获得用户信息。③、用户身份校验通过后,后台服务将生成token返回客户端。客户端请求后续其他接口时,需要带上这个token。...服务端会统一拦截接口请求,进行Token有效性校验,并从中获取用户信息,供后续业务逻辑使用

1.6K00

创建可调大小用户窗体——使用Windows API

标签:VBA,Windows API使用VBA创建用户窗体时,通常会将其设置为特定大小。然而,通过一些编码技巧,可以为其实现类似的调整大小效果。...本文代码能够实现:允许调整用户窗体大小;调整窗体大小时用户窗体Resize事件能捕获;每次Resize事件后,对象大小或位置都会发生变化。...DrawMenuBar windowHandle End Sub 上面的两个代码段创建了一个可重复使用过程,可以使用它来打开或关闭调整用户窗体大小设置。...如果想要能够调整用户窗体大小,使用: Call ResizeWindowSettings(myUserForm, True) 关闭调整用户窗体大小,使用: Call ResizeWindowSettings...示例 在VBE中,插入一个用户窗体,如下图1所示。 图1 可以看到,该用户窗体上包括一个名为“lstListBOx”列表框和一个名为“cmdClose”命令按钮。

34530

Laravel 中使用简单方法跟踪用户是否在线(推荐)

今天,我任务是,在Laravel应用程序用户个人资料页面上,用户名旁边添加一个绿点,表示他们是否在线。我首先想到是,我们将需要启动一个node.js服务器并跟踪每个用户活动套接字连接。...一位同事指出,对于目前需求,MySpace用来处理“在线”功能方式可能就足够了。就我们所知,MySpace用来显示用户是否在线方式是基于他们在网站上最后一项活动。...然后当我们需要检查用户是否在线,我们可以将该时间戳与当前时间戳进行比较,如果在X分钟内,则他们在线!...缓存好处是可以简化这种方法,因为可以设置缓存为过期。 现在我们决定使用缓存实现这个特性,下一个问题是这个代码应该在哪里运行,以便它在每个请求上运行?...总结 以上所述是小编给大家介绍Laravel 中使用简单方法跟踪用户是否在线,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家

2.2K41

SSO单点登录使用token机制来验证用户安全性

// "心跳包" 用来检测用户是否在线!用来做长连接! http:短连接使用token 机制来验证用户安全性 // token 值: 登录令牌! 用来判断当前用户登录状态!...,公共参数附带越多,越利于后台监测用户,数据挖掘会使用到监测到数据. // 以后客户端再次发送网络请求(一般不是登录请求)时候,就会将这个 token 值附带到参数中发送给服务器....{ 每次登录之后,无论用户密码是否改变,只要调用登录接口并且登录成功,都会在服务器生成新token值,原来token值就会失效!...可以设置多个token 根据登录端不同 ,来检测token 是否过期。...appRedirectURI只对网页应用有效,所以这里可以随便填一个或者使用默认

4.6K50

认证鉴权也可以如此简单—使用API网关保护你API安全

RP使用上一步获得code来请求Token EndPoint,这一步OAuth2。...能带来什么: 保护业务API安全性。 用户可以使用自己用户体系对自己API进行授权。 授权范围: API网关会认为有效token有权访问与该授权API绑定所有业务API。...向客户颁发token形式由用户根据具体业务场景决定,可以将颁发token功能部署到生产环境,配置成普通API后由访问者通过用户名密码获得,也可以直接在本地环境生成token 后,直接拷贝给指定用户使用...使用 id_token 请求业务 API 时,API 网关将检验 id_token 合法性,同时校验访问用户是否具有访问该 API 权限,API 网关将只放行具有访问权限用户请求。...、用户Id、服务Id、API Id>信息来判断用户是否有权限访问该服务下API

9.5K155

慕课网Flask构建可扩展RESTful API-5. Token与HTTPBasic验证 —— 用令牌来管理用户

5.1 Token 1.Token概述 以下是网站登录和使用API登录区别 ?...Token具有有效期 Token可以标示用户身份,如存储用户id 2.获取Token令牌 密码校验--models/user.py @staticmethod def verify(email, password..._password, raw) 返回token试图函数,这里稍微破坏一下REST规则,由于登录操作密码安全性较高,使用GET的话会泄漏 @api.route('', methods=['POST']...用处 我们不可能让任何一个用户都来访问我们获取用户资料接口,必须对这个加以控制,也就是说只有确定了身份用户可以访问我们接口。...当用户访问问接口时候,我们需要获取他传来token并进行解析验证,只有token是合法且没有过期,我们才允许访问。

1.3K50

Keycloak单点登录平台|技术雷达

(图片来自:SAML2.0 wiki) 上图是使用SAML协议时,用户首次登录一种最常用工作流(SP Redirect Request; IdP POST Response),也是Keycloak...用户请求Service Provider(简称SP),通过SessionID判断是否存在已鉴权Context,否则返回302,重定向至Identity Provider(简称IdP),并携带参数,IdP...检测是否已经存在鉴权Context,否则要求用户提供凭证(例如普通用户名密码输入框),成功后返回302,并将数据返回给SP。...另一种方式是针对提供RESTful API服务,这种情况下必须使用OpenID Connect协议,这种协议建立在Auth2.0之上,所以,可以将access_token通过Http头方式来获取权限信息...缺点包括: 很多范例使用JSP、Servlet,对使用SpringBoot用户不太友好; 导入导出配置仅可以在启动时设置,这个在使用Docker容器时,极其不友好; 授权访问配置导出尚存在Bug; 授权

5.1K30

java使用 Base64 实现用户信息加密与解密,相当于token

1 问题 springboot 项目需要实现对用户加密和解密 用户登陆之后,对用户信息进行加密存到cookie ,之后访问页面的时候,携带这个cokkie 到其他页面,然后进行解密,只要cookie...过期,那么页面就访问不了 2 实现 1 实体类 用户信息实体类 import com.alibaba.fastjson.JSONObject; import com.fasterxml.jackson.databind.annotation.JsonSerialize...AllArgsConstructor @NoArgsConstructor @ToString public class UserToken { /** * sessionID 用来判断是否过期...,相当于签名 private static final String SINGNATURE_TOKEN = "PIESAT_TOKEN"; /** * 将用户信息加密...获取用户信息 解码字符串 * * @param token * @return */ public static String decoder(String

27230

沿着这7个思路,你可以正确使用动效取悦用户

何时使用愉悦动效 就像其他元素一样,动效应该对整个用户流程起到支撑作用。愉悦动效能够让用户更快乐地使用产品,而不会影响整体可用性。愉悦动效能够通过两种方式提升UX: ·强化娱乐和参与感。...情感化设计目的是创造幸福感,我想你是希望用户在在使用产品时候,感到快乐。 接下来,我们分享7种借助动效取悦用户方法。...1、等待加载时保持用户愉悦感 考虑到目前存储技术和硬件计算力,用户总会在不同环节不可避免面对加载过程。当我们不能缩短加载过程时候,可以试着让用户这个等待过程更加有趣。...为了确保他们不会在等待时候无聊,最好是借助动效让用户分心,从而降低他们对于时间敏感度。这些动效可以是有趣,也可以是出人意料。...2、创造良好第一印象 当人们判断一个事物好坏时候,第一印象非常重要。好第一印象能够让用户对产品或者服务产生兴趣,主动推进新用户流程,甚至能够优化使用过程中心境。

64180

网络攻击者可以使用特权用户凭证3种隐藏方式

通过“钥匙”,他们可以轻松地、无声地从一个系统移动到另一个系统,更改域属性,添加权限,更改密码以及连接到域中任何计算机。大多数企业将大量资源用于仔细管理域服务器,并使用各种技术和实践来控制访问权限。...假设财务部门员工打电话给内部服务台,询问连接或应用程序问题。服务台人员使用域管理员凭据远程访问系统,进行故障排除并解决问题,但会在没有正确注销情况下结束会话。...但是,为了提高效率,通常使用包含默认本地管理员用户系统映像(黄金映像)和相同默认密码构建标准端点。虽然这可能使IT管理员更方便,但攻击者现在有机会使用一个密码访问多台计算机。...但是,如果没有适当注意,这可能会导致一种虚假安全感。通过操作访问控制列表(ACL),网络攻击者可以提升用户权限,从而创建具有域管理员访问但不属于域管理员组“影子管理员”。...一个客户,刚刚接过新工作安全专员,故意分配给普通用户提升了相当于域管理员权限。 当然,恶意IT人员或其他内部人员也可以故意创建影子管理员,也可能会意外创建影子管理员。

44630

PHP7使用openssl解密易班API用户数据

PHP7使用openssl解密易班API用户数据 一、mcrypt扩展解密   自从PHP版本更新到了7.1以上以后,mcrypt扩展被废弃,使用mcrypt扩展会出现如下图报错。...只能使用openssl来代替。 ?   ...然而易班轻应用提供还是旧版本mcrypt扩展,这将导致php版本升级到7.1以上版本会提示没有这个函数,以下是易班文档中心提供解密代码,使用加密方式为AES-128-CBC。 <?..."雨落凋殇", "usernick": "雨落凋殇", "usersex": "M" }, "visit_oauth": { "access_token": "ca2441e60276fab919c12150dd15d9fade201e48...", "token_expires": "1566922131" } } 三、总结   经过上面的mcrypt解密方式AES-128-CBC转换为openssl后必须使用AES-256-CBC

1.1K31

WSO2 ESB(5)

此外,这些Web应用程序可以继承像认证/授权,从WSO2碳平台用户管理等功能。 WSO2公司AppServer全力支持XML,SOAP,WSDL,并支持可靠,安全通信。...WSO2应用服务器,它简单而有效创建,使用和管理Web服务。...应用服务器可以使用在多种不同方案: 现有的或新业务应用作为Web服务公开。...默认用户名和密码登录到WSO2应用服务器管理控制台: 用户名:admin 密码:admin 管理控制台可以指向不同应用服务器节点,在生产系统中。...这是可以做到在登录框上使用“服务器URL”项。 要解决任何问题签署,请按一下“登入说明” ? 管理控制台主页将包含系统总结 ? 故障服务 ? 服务组管理 ?

2.3K90

调查称全球多所顶尖高校网站存在网络攻击风险

攻击者可以利用这些来接管网站、重定向到恶意服务器、从官方通信渠道进行网络钓鱼以及访问用户信息。...台湾大学 (NTU) 网站泄露了 JSON Web Token 机密、数据库凭据和带有用户 git URL。这些都可能使攻击者能够劫持帐户并获得管理员访问权限。...不应被公开环境文件 环境文件不应让外部人员访问,因为这些文件是配置文件,通常包含 Web 应用程序使用部分或全部第三方服务、数据库和 API 凭证。...攻击者可能会使用暴露凭证来访问私有数据库并滥用 API 函数。在某些情况下,泄露凭证可能会导致整个网站遭到入侵。...关于泄露凭证,研究发现,有两所高校使用了给定软件默认凭证,5所大学使用了弱密码,反映出这些高校在安全实践上不足,并暗示了用于其他应用程序凭证也可能同样使用了弱密码。

23850

实战|这个炫酷播放粒子效果,你也可以学会!使用Web动画API制作

在本文中,单击按钮时,我们将使用Web Animations API创建烟花效果,从而制作更多粒子魔术。 效果如下 ? 本文演示和完整代码已经放在我博客小码页面 ? 让我们开始吧!...HTML设置 该演示不需要太多HTML,我们将使用一个 元素,但它可以是另一种类型标签元素。如果我们真的想的话,我们甚至可以听到页面上任何点击声,让粒子从任何地方弹出。...因为您可以在HTML中创建自定义标签元素,所以我将使用 标签名称来避免使用语义标签。但事实是,您可以为 , 或您选择任何标记设置动画。...我们还将删除指针事件,以避免HTML粒子在屏幕上时与用户任何交互。 因为样式化按钮和页面布局并不是本文真正目的,所以我将把它放在一边。...使每个粒子淡出时,将其从鼠标位置动画化到随机位置 动画完成后,从DOM中删除 步骤1:点击事件 // 我们首先检查浏览器是否支持Web Animations API if (document.body.animate

1K10

微服务架构下统一身份认证和授权

在开放平台上,应当提供一套完善界面和流程,以引导用户完成开发者认证和第三方应用接入所有工作。此外,在前期阶段,也可以采用线下申请方式,由管理员人工审核,在后台手动录入。...接入流程和步骤,与第三步骤『成为开发者,获取 IBCS 能力集』一致,由开放平台提供标准 API,第三方按照接入规范执行。 4....授权码模式(authorization code) 外部服务鉴权 用户在 APP 上使用图像识别服务,APP 调用 IBCS 图像识别 API 并返回结果给用户 密码模式(resource owner...SSO 应用中; 对于域 SSO 应用,一般是企业内部应用,或相关性较高应用,这些应用域名采用相同父级域名,继续使用 Cookie 方案; 对于跨域 SSO 应用,不提供 SSO 状态保持。...对于安全性要求不高场景,也可以使用 HTTP Basic 验证进行简单鉴权。

3.5K50

微信小游戏“跳一跳”,是如何使用户得知可以距离?

游戏功能开放,与线下场景结合,本来是坐着冷板凳小程序一下子就进入了我们视野,估计他们策略就是,“别废话,先让用户玩起来,用起来,中起毒来,传播起来”。...朋友发来了一个跳一跳经验总结,原来并不是跳每个格子都只加一分,有些格子甚至可以加 30 分!只要你在上面乖乖站 2 秒钟不要动。 请注意下面是攻略哦! 盖+5 分。...跳在这个井盖上面,待 2 秒钟,就可以 +5 分。 魔方+10 分。同样是待够 2 秒钟,就可以加额外分数。 徐记士多店+15 分。...大家看到这个徐记士多店时候,跳上去可以 +15 分,成功跳上去之后还可以看到商店门会打开。 音乐盒+30 分。调到这个音乐盒上面待两秒钟,会听到美妙圣诞音乐,还能额外 +30 分。...可爱微信气泡狗。 有的盒子上写着 433 天,这是为了纪念微信在上线 433 天之后,用户量破亿。 还有苹果 iPod 系列经典产品 iPod Shuffle。

1.2K80
领券